Full form CBSE – ICSE
CBSE – Central Board Of Secondary Education
ICSE- Indian Certificate of Secondary Education
Advantages of CBSE
CBSE is more popular in India as compare to ICSE
CBSE being older more schools follows CBSE pattern syllabus and education methods. That is why CBSE pattern is more popular. This will help you to find a school for your kid in case you are switching to new city in India. If you want to travel abroad then you will find more CBSE pattern schools outside India than ICSE schools. CBSE is recognized by Indian government and ICSE is not. Popularity of ICSE is growing day by day though.
- CBSE is recommended for parents who have to move in different cities in India as part of their job profile. CBSE has more schools in India their children will not face any issue while switching schools.
- ICSE is recommended for parents who have to move in different countries as part of their job. ICSE is more compatible to the world as compare to CBSE. ICSE child will face less difficulty which changing his school internationally.
CBSE has less syllabus volume as compare to ICSE
Some students may find ICSE syllabus vast as ICSE have more syllabus and subjects. Sixth grade ICSE student will face 12-13 subject examinations while CBSE student will face on 5-6 subject examinations.
CBSE board helps more in engineering and medical field
CBSE is more focuses on maths and science. This helps students for engineering and medical entrance exams. Prior CBSE experience will be always helpful for students doing their medical and engineering.
CBSE has more Scholarships and talent search exams
ICSE being newer has got less numbers of scholarship exams. CBSE has lot of talent search examinations for the students. All major competitive examination in India are based on the CBSE syllabus. (IIT-JEE – Indian Institute Of Technology Joint Entrance Examination, AIEEE – All India Engineering Entrance Examination, AIPMT – All India Pre Medical Test).
Advantages of ICSE
ICSE has more balanced Syllabus for child’s overall growth
CBSE syllabus is easier as compare to ICSE. CBSE syllabus is focus more on Science and Maths. On the other hand syllabus followed by the ICSE board is more comprehensive and complete, which gives all fields with equal importance. (like – science, maths, language, arts, home science, agriculture, fashion design,cookery). By choosing ICSE you are giving opportunity for your child to work on his overall growth.
ICSE prefers to give more practical knowledge and teach better analytical skills
Compare to CBSE, ICSE is more towards giving practical knowledge to the students. They taught their syllabus theoretical a well as practical. This gives students effective understanding of subject and learn better analytical skills.
In ICSE student has more Subjects Flexibility
ICSE is having advantage here. Students in ICSE can choose different subjects. They could select vocational courses as per their interest. In CBSE students have to follow more pure academic subjects.
ICSE prefers more student Assessments
In ICSE (internal) assessments are very important. More practical tests are conducted with all the subjects and scores. ICSE gives more preference to lab work it is more practical oriented.
ICSE board helps more on management carriers
The way ICSE syllabus, its subjects and teaching methodology is designed it will be more helpful for students who wants to pursue their carriers in management streams.
ICSE certificate will be recognised around the world
Certificate given by ICSE to the students will be recognized more around the world as compare to CBSE. Overall syllabus (like languages) of ICSE will give slight upper hand in english to their students. This will help them some exams which are based on english.
Common factors between CBSE and ICSE
- CBSE and ICSE both recognised by colleges in India.
- Subjects taught in ICSE and CBSE are almost same.
- Quality of education provided by both boards is excellent.
CBSE and ICSE both follows learn through experience teaching method
CBSE & ICSE both education patterns follows way of learning through experience. To follow methods defined in respective pattern is always depend on school and teacher.This can be vary from school to school.
What parents should do
Both these boards CBSE and ICSE have their own advantages and disadvantages. Parents have to choose the board for their children based up on what future you aspires for your child.
Parents always have concern with quality of education. You should identify the best school for your child who will give him quality education. Which means for you selecting right school should be on priority instead of selecting right board for your child.
